Main Purpose of Job

To provide speech, language and aural rehabilitation services to MSD students, including those who may have multiple disabilities. Speech-Language services help support a bilingual approach by facilitating and enhancing student communication skills.\r\n

POSITION DUTIES

Administer language,\r\nspeech and auditory skill diagnostic evaluations;\r\n\r\n\r\nConduct speech,\r\nlanguage, speech reading and auditory skills development;\r\n\r\n\r\nEvaluate treatment and\r\nrevise as necessary;\r\n\r\n\r\nPrepare and maintain\r\nnecessary records and report on student services and progress;\r\n\r\n\r\nParticipate in team\r\nand community meetings;\r\n\r\n\r\nServe as an IEP team\r\nmember, determine present levels of performance and establish goals\r\nspecifically addressed to student needs;\r\n\r\n\r\nUse developmentally\r\nappropriate activities, a variety of therapy materials and oral-motor\r\nstrategies as needed;\r\nAdapt therapy\r\nstrategies to facilitate student progress, including service delivery methods\r\n(services both inside and outside of the classroom);\r\n\r\n\r\nConsult with other\r\nprofessional and nonprofessional personnel, including conferences with parents\r\nand classroom staff, concerning student performance;\r\n\r\n\r\nAssist with training\r\nof classroom staff regarding amplification equipment, feeding/swallowing\r\nprecautions and/or augmentative communication use;\r\n\r\n\r\nConduct and\r\nparticipate in seminars, in-service and professional training programs;\r\n\r\n\r\nMaintain confidentiality\r\npertaining to students care;\r\n\r\n\r\nAssume other\r\nresponsibilities as designated by the Department Head.\r\n\r\n\r\nCandidate should have:\r\nKnowledge of the\r\ntheory, principles and practices of speech-language pathology;\r\n\r\n\r\nEvaluations and\r\ntreatment should be conducted with the unique deaf and hard of hearing\r\npopulation in mind. Considerations of hearing levels, language abilities and\r\ncultural diversity are essential to meeting the needs of this population.\r\n\r\n\r\nProficiency with or\r\nthe ability to use a variety of computer programs and applications (i.e.\r\nGoogle, MS Word, Boardmaker, Maryland Online IEP program, etc.)\r\n\r\n\r\nSkill in basic level\r\nof sign language a must with willingness to improve ASL skills to achieve\r\nfluency.\r\n\r\n\r\nAdditional desirable\r\nknowledge: Phonological Awareness, ABA experience, AAC experience,\r\nFeeding/Swallowing experience.\r\n
